DICK'S Sporting Goods has an employee rating of 3.8 out of 5 stars, based on 12,168 company reviews on Glassdoor which indicates that most employees have a good working experience there. The DICK'S Sporting Goods employee rating is in line with the average (within 1 standard deviation) for employers within the Retail & Wholesale industry (3.4 stars).

Pros

Some nice co-workers. I heard that the discount was ok, but never used it (due to needing to pay bills first).

Cons

Hours being cut in half on a weekly basis. Being asked to fill in a shift when already scheduled at another job. Always hearing about the annoying "Metrics" requirements every 10 to 15 minutes over the radio. How "The Team Needs to make the goals". Having to "make payroll". Canceled trucks which cuts hours off of the non-student (high school and/or college) staff that are trying to work to cover bills. Not enough coverage on the sales floor in certain departments, leaving 1 associate to cover 2 floors. Having to deal with scheduling conflicts from this location. Not enough cashiers scheduled during the rush periods causing a constant need for back up cashier from the other departments.

Pros

Decent benefit package, reasonable discount (access if you know where to look), reasonable hours (if your managers like you/listen to you), and decent compensation (if you don't need a liveable wage)

Cons

No focus on training be it management or staff, often understaffed in store meaning more upset customers for every single associate to deal with, a culture focused on metrics, metrics, metrics and not fixing whats wrong, and a lot of smoke and mirrors when upper management is visiting.
